We recently had to find a hotel in Leicester Square that had access for disabled people. We came up with Victory House, M Gallery by Sofitel, with 86 bedrooms of which a stunning 6 are accessible according to the website (although their reception said they had 4). Update 2018: Charlotte’s Place , an institution in West London (Ealing), has now been audited. It is accessible but only the front entrance is wide enough for wheelchair. There’s also a small step.
